Oilers Make Offer to Anaheim’s Dustin Penner
The Edmonton Oilers have inked Anaheim Ducks forward Dustin Penner to a five-year offer sheet that will earn the Winkler, Manitoba native approximately $21.25 million. The $4.25 million per season Penner is a great deal over the league minimum $450,000 that he earned last season in the last year of his entry-level contract. If...

The Senators and Emery Agree on Three-Year Deal
The Ottawa Senators and goal keeper Ray Emery agreed on a three-year deal on Tuesday avoiding salary arbitration. The will earn Ray Emery about $9.5 million making him one of the highest paid goalies in the NHL, the Ottawa Sun wrote.
